Abstract

The present invention includes compositions and methods for reduce the taste of the drug in the drug resin complex. The composition may include one or more drug-resin complexes and a highly compressible, free-flowing pharmaceutical excipient. The resin is present in an amount effective to reduce the taste of the drug in the drug resin complex relative to an otherwise identical pharmaceutical composition without the resin; and wherein the highly compressible, free-flowing pharmaceutical excipient causes release of the drug-resin complex in the mouth.

Claims (31)

1. A compressed, orally disintegrating, controlled release taste-masked pharmaceutical composition comprising:

a coated drug-ion-exchange resin complex and a directly compressible, free-flowing pharmaceutical excipient,

wherein the composition effectively masks an unpalatable taste associated with delivery of the drug,

wherein the coated drug-ion-exchange resin complex is coated with a controlled release coating,

and wherein the directly compressible, free-flowing pharmaceutical excipient aids in the liberation of the coated drug-resin complex in the mouth through disintegration.

2.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the drug in the drug-ion-exchange resin complex comprises dextromethorphan, codeine, morphine, hydrocodone, hyoscyamine, moguisteine, pseudoephedrine, chlorpheniramine, phenylprop anolamine, pharmaceutically acceptable salts of the same or combinations thereof.

3. The composition of claim 1 , further comprising one or more flavorants, sweeteners, coolants, dyes, or combinations and mixtures thereof.

4. The composition of claim 1 , further comprising one or more excipients, one or more binders or combinations and mixtures thereof.

5.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the coated drug-ion-exchange resin complex comprises polistirex, polacrilex or combinations thereof.

6.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the composition comprises pseudoephedrine polistirex and chlorpheniramine polacrilex.

7.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the resin in the coated drug-ion-exchange resin complex comprises one or more cationic exchange resins.

8.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the coated drug-ion-exchange resin complex comprises a divinylbenzene sulfonic acid cationic exchange resin.

9.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the composition comprises a hardness of between about 5 and about 15 kPa.

10.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the composition has at least about 20 percent better mouth-feel.

11.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the coated drug-ion-exchange resin complex controlled release coating comprises a diffusion barrier coating.

12. The composition of claim 11 , wherein the diffusion barrier coating is a time release coating.
